NYS NO Rent 1 yr (by Ken [NY]) Posted on: Nov 15, 2023 11:00 AM
Message:

If you loose a housing case and the judge orders your eviction,you can ask the court for up to 1 year to move if you can show that you cannot find a similar apartment in the same neighborhood.The judge will take into account your health conditions,whther you have children enrolled in school,the hardship of the landlord if you remain and any other life circumstances that could affect your ability to move. --74.77.xx.xx

NYS NO Rent 1 yr (by Small potatoes [NY]) Posted on: Nov 15, 2023 11:19 PM
Message:

Unless I'm missing something they have to pay to stay, and yes hardship was further defined in 2019 to include the unhealthy who might be bed ridden and families who would otherwise have to interrupt juniors school year. I think it would be hard for tenant to show they actually contacted other lls and were rejected but a judge might sympathize w them. --172.59.xxx.xxx
